- Read those reviews, folks! Online reviews are your best friend. Sites like Google Maps, Yelp, and even Facebook are goldmines of information. Look for shops with consistently positive reviews. Pay attention to what people are saying about the quality of service, the speed of the repairs, and the overall experience. Are people happy with the results? Are there any red flags mentioned (like repeated issues or poor communication)?
- Experience matters, big time. Find out how long the shop has been in business. Experienced technicians are more likely to have seen it all and know how to handle various iPhone problems. Ask about their experience with your specific iPhone model. While many repair shops can fix common issues, some repairs, like motherboard repairs or data recovery, require specialized knowledge and equipment.
- Ask about the parts. Does the shop use genuine Apple parts or third-party replacements? Genuine parts are generally more expensive, but they ensure the best quality and performance. If the shop uses third-party parts, ask about their quality and warranty. A reputable shop will be transparent about the parts they use.
- Check for warranties. A good repair shop will offer a warranty on their work, usually for a certain period. This shows they stand behind their repairs and are confident in their abilities. The warranty should cover both the parts and the labor.
- Get a quote, and compare. Before you commit to anything, get a quote for the repair. Different shops may charge different prices for the same repair. Compare quotes from several shops to find the best deal. But remember, the cheapest option isn't always the best. Consider the other factors, such as reviews and experience, when making your decision.
- Don't be afraid to ask questions! A good repair shop will be happy to answer your questions and explain the repair process. Ask about the estimated time to repair, the cost, and any potential risks involved. The more informed you are, the better.
- Cracked Screen: This is probably the most common problem. Dropping your phone is practically a rite of passage! Repairing a cracked screen usually involves replacing the entire front assembly, which includes the glass, the digitizer (the touchscreen component), and the LCD display. The technician will carefully remove the broken screen, disconnect the internal components, and install a new screen assembly.
- Battery Replacement: iPhones, just like any other smartphone, have batteries that degrade over time. If your iPhone battery drains quickly, or if your phone suddenly shuts down, it's probably time for a battery replacement. The technician will remove the old battery and install a new one. This is a relatively straightforward repair, but it's important to have it done by a professional to avoid damaging the phone.
- Water Damage: Uh oh, water and electronics don't mix! If your iPhone has taken a swim, the first thing to do is turn it off immediately. Then, bring it to a repair shop ASAP. The technician will disassemble the phone, clean the internal components to remove any water residue, and assess the damage. Water damage can cause various problems, from corrosion to short circuits, so the repair can be complex and expensive.
- Charging Port Issues: If your iPhone won't charge or if the charging cable keeps disconnecting, the charging port might be damaged. This is often caused by debris getting into the port or by physical damage to the pins. The technician will clean the port or replace the charging connector.
- Software Issues: Sometimes, the problem isn't hardware-related. Software glitches, like freezing, slow performance, or app crashes, can often be fixed with a software update, a factory reset, or a software reinstallation. The technician can diagnose the software issue and implement the appropriate fix.
- Camera Problems: If your iPhone camera isn't working correctly (blurry pictures, black screen, etc.), the camera module might need to be replaced. The technician will replace the camera module with a new one.
- Button Malfunctions: The power button, volume buttons, and home button can sometimes stop working. The technician will diagnose the issue and replace the faulty button or its associated components.
- Screen Repair: Cracked screens are a common issue, and the cost of repair depends on the iPhone model. Newer models with advanced display technologies will generally cost more to repair than older models. Expect to pay anywhere from a few hundred thousand Rupiahs to over a million for a screen replacement.
- Battery Replacement: Replacing the battery is usually more affordable than a screen repair. The cost will depend on the iPhone model and whether you choose a genuine Apple battery or a third-party replacement. You can typically budget a few hundred thousand Rupiahs for this repair.
- Water Damage Repair: Water damage repairs can be unpredictable in terms of cost. It depends on the extent of the damage. If the damage is extensive, the repair costs can be significant, potentially reaching into the millions of Rupiahs. The technician will have to assess the internal components to determine what needs to be replaced. Remember, the longer you wait to fix water damage, the more expensive it will be.
- Charging Port Repair: Repairing a charging port is usually less expensive than a screen or battery replacement. The cost depends on whether the technician can simply clean the port or if they need to replace the connector. You can expect to pay a few hundred thousand Rupiahs for this repair.
- Other Repairs: The cost of other repairs, such as camera repairs, button replacements, or software fixes, will vary depending on the complexity of the issue. The repair shop should provide a detailed quote after diagnosing the problem. Be sure to ask for an itemized breakdown of the costs.

- Get a screen protector: A good-quality screen protector can save your screen from scratches and cracks. There are various types available, from tempered glass to plastic film.
- Use a protective case: A case provides an extra layer of protection against drops and impacts. Choose a case that fits your iPhone model and offers good protection for the corners and edges.
- Be careful around water: While some iPhones are water-resistant, it's best to avoid exposing them to water. If your iPhone does get wet, turn it off immediately and dry it thoroughly.
- Avoid extreme temperatures: Extreme heat or cold can damage your iPhone's battery and internal components. Don't leave your iPhone in direct sunlight or in a hot car.
- Handle your iPhone with care: Avoid dropping your phone, and be mindful of where you place it. Don't put your phone in your back pocket if you are prone to sitting down suddenly.
- Keep the charging port clean: Use a soft brush or compressed air to clean out any dust or debris that might accumulate in the charging port.
- Update your software regularly: Software updates often include bug fixes and security patches that can improve your iPhone's performance and stability.
- Back up your data: Regularly back up your iPhone to iCloud or your computer. This way, if something happens to your phone, you won't lose your precious photos, contacts, and other data.
